This two-deck set of Sierra Nevada mountain wildflower playing cards features 108 species (54 per deck) of California wildflowers. Each deck's back design has a beautiful full-color photograph of the Sierra Nevada Mountains. The face of each card includes a plant photograph, the common and scientific names of the wildflowers, as well as facts about each species. The cards are made of durable, high-quality paper stock, and are intended for both casual play and educational use.
